France is analyzing the possibility of imposing local reconfinements to prevent a new outbreak of the coronavirus pandemic, which reaches alarming levels in England and has exceeded one million cases in South Africa.

 

Vaccination campaigns are accelerating in Europe and the United States to control the virus, which killed more than 1.7 million people - including 186,000 in Russia, which revised its numbers up - and infected more than 80 million, but the WHO is concerned about what is to come, and that it could be "worse" than seen so far.

 

France, despite the hopes raised by the start of the vaccination campaign, closes the year under the threat of a possible new confinement, which could be local according to certain officials, and which was the subject of study by a defense council meeting on Tuesday morning and chaired by Head of State Emmanuel Macron.

 

In the last seven days, 12,000 new cases of contagion were detected daily in France, far from the 5,000 target set by the government.

 

In England, the number of hospitalized for covid-19 exceeded the peak of the first wave, with 20,426 people admitted on Monday, and the number of infections reached a new record of 41,385. Since the beginning of the pandemic, more than 2.3 million people have been infected and 71,000 have died from covid-19 in the country.

 

"Here we are again in the eye of the hurricane with a second wave of coronavirus sweeping Europe and this country," declared the director general of the NHS (the British national health service), Simon Stevens, in a video posted on Twitter.

 

Spain receives new vaccines


Spain received "more than 350,000 doses" of the Pfizer / BioNTech vaccine against covid-19 on Tuesday, the day after a logistics incident in Belgium that prevented its delivery early on Monday, the government announced.

 

With more than 50,000 dead since the start of the pandemic, according to the official count, Spain received the first doses on Saturday, December 26. The long-awaited vaccination campaign began on Sunday, like most countries in the European Union, and on Monday it should receive this first large shipment.

 

However, delivery in Spain - and in seven other European countries that were not specified - was delayed 24 hours by a "minor logistical problem," said Pfizer, which is distributing the vaccine throughout Europe from its Puurs factory. (Belgium).

 

Belarus announced on Tuesday the start of its vaccination campaign with the arrival of the first batch of Russian Sputnik V vaccines.

 

In recent days, batches of Sputnik V have been sent to Argentina - so far, the only Latin American country to authorize this vaccine and which received 300,000 doses last week - and to Hungary. Moscow hopes to have "millions of doses" by next year.
